WebNov 17, 2024 · If you fishing from the bank or in a boat and wanting to chum, I would suggest getting a large (coke can sized) plastic bottle with a screw on lid. Drill or punch a bunch of smaller holes in the plastic. Grind your chum and fill the bottle. WebMay 16, 2009 · We typically use one entire cake in each hole we are baiting (chumming) for channel catfish when using cottonseed cakes. Range cubes come in fifty pound bags and will cost about $5 to $6 a bag and one fifty pound bag will bait about 6-8 areas. (Typically about 1 gallon to 1.5 gallons of range cubes per hole for chumming).
